Preparing Your Wallet for Airdrops

Follow this checklist to airdrop-proof your setup:

  • Install MetaMask or a compatible Web3 wallet
  • Add Arbitrum Network: Use ChainID 42161 and RPC details from chainlist.org
  • Fund with Minimal ETH: Keep 0.01-0.05 ETH for claim transactions
  • Use a Dedicated Address: Isolate airdrop activity from main holdings

Red Flags: How to Spot Airdrop Scams

Protect yourself from fraud with these warnings:

  • ❌ Requests for private keys or seed phrases
  • ❌ Websites without HTTPS encryption
  • ❌ Unsolicited DMs offering “guaranteed” ETH
  • ❌ Demands for upfront payment
  • ❌ Typos in URLs (e.g., arb1trum[.]com)
